Orange-Apricot Dessert

Prep: 10 min

A refreshing and fruity dessert featuring mandarin oranges and apricot yogurt, topped with whipped cream and nuts—perfect for a light, sweet treat suitable for any occasion.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 2 (11 oz.) cans mandarin orange sections
  • 2 (8 oz.) cartons apricot-flavored yogurt
  • whipped topping
  • nuts

Instructions

  1. Drain the mandarin orange sections and combine them with apricot-flavored yogurt.
  2. Place the mixture in a glass bowl.
  3. Garnish with whipped topping and nuts.
  4. Serve immediately.
